| In this study,alumina/zirconia spinning solution was prepared by sol-gel method with aluminum powder,hydrochloric acid,acetic acid,and zirconium oxychloride as the raw material,using polyvinyl alcohol(PVA)as spinning additives.The impact of the ratio of raw materials,concentration temperature,moisture content,PVA added amount and type of PVA to the stability,rheology and spinning of alumina/zirconia spinning solution was studied.The impact of fiber-forming crafts on fiber morphology and the diameter of the fibers were described.Some research on heat treatments is done at the same time.The experient show that:(1)Zirconia and alumina were uniformly mixed according to the ratio of 40%~50%.And after distillated at 75 ℃,the most stable alumina/zirconia spinning solution was obtained;When the moisture content of alumina/zirconia spinning solution was from 35%to 45%,and the internal temperature of system were in the range of 35-45 ℃,alumina/zirconia spinning solution had the best rheology.According to m(zirconium oxychloride):m(zirconium acetate)=(0.5 to 0.9): 1,zirconium oxychloride and zirconium acetate were configured as zirconium solution.And adding 1788 type PVA(accounting for the sum of the quality of alumina and zirconia)with the mass fraction of 7%,aged for about3-6d between 25 ℃ and 45 ℃,The alumina/zirconia spinning solution had the best spinnability.(2)When the temperature of ompressed air at about 50 ℃,the speed of compressed air between 12m/s and 16m/s,the temperature of cotton collection system between 40 ℃ and50 ℃ and relative humidity of about 20%,the rotation speed of spinning disk between20 Hz and 25 Hz,the precursor fibers with uniform diameter,fewer defects,low content of slag balls were obtained.The average diameter of fibers increased with the increase of the speed of compressed air.When selecting the speed of compressed gas from 15m/s-17m/s,the diameter distribution of fiber was more concentrated and the average diameter was fit.(3)Special heat treatment was required from room temperature to 500 ℃,and the heating rate was 5 ℃/min from room temperature to 500 ℃;The optimum calcination temperature of alumina/zirconia precursor composite fibers was 1300 ℃;The holding time was not more than 90 min at 1300 ℃,80 min as the best heat preservation period.(4)Alumina/zirconia composite fibers prepared in this experiment were soft with the diameter between 4um and 6um.And the content of slag balls was less than 2%.The vibration grinding rate was about 5%.It can be used at 1300 ℃ for a long time. |
